Wasabi vs. Backblaze B2: Cloud Object Storage Comparison (2026)

When choosing the ideal cloud object storage for your organization, looking at price per terabyte is only scratching the surface. While hyperscaler fees can often cause cloud storage costs to spiral out of control, Wasabi Hot Cloud Storage and Backblaze B2 are both positioned as cost-effective alternatives to hyperscaler storage, but they serve meaningfully different needs.

This comparison breaks down how the two platforms stack up across pricing, security, global reach, partner support, and enterprise features — so you can make an informed decision based on your actual workload requirements, not just the headline rate. For organizations evaluating cloud storage beyond a simple dollars-per-terabyte comparison, the differences are significant.

Why enterprises choose Wasabi over Backblaze B2

Backblaze B2 competes primarily on lower pay-as-you-go list pricing, slightly more generous egress allowances, and the absence of minimum retention charges. However, enterprises evaluating long-term object storage strategy should also consider:

  • Advanced security features such as Multi-User Authentication (MUA) and Covert Copy air-gapped storage

  • A larger partner ecosystem

  • Free, UI-based account management tools that simplify and scale multi-tenant and multi-layered storage environments

  • Broader global reach

  • A more flexible reserved capacity pricing program with higher potential discounts (and more margin for partners)

  • A business model that complements rather than competes with backup vendors

For organizations prioritizing security, partner enablement, ecosystem support, and enterprise storage specialization, Wasabi presents a compelling alternative that extends beyond a simple $/TB comparison.

Covert Copy is a feature of Wasabi Hot Cloud Storage which provides logically air-gapped storage to prevent and minimize the impact of insider threats and ransomware attacks. Covert Copy enables Wasabi admins with Root access to create a hidden, inaccessible, and tamper-proof copy of their data. Only the Root user, using Multi-User Authentication, can make the data accessible when absolutely necessary. Covert Copy is a free feature; you only pay for the incremental storage capacity.

Wasabi has 16 storage regions around the globe, including 6 in North America, including Toronto, Ontario, 6 in Europe, 4 in Asia with more regions coming online.

Yes, Wasabi Reserved Capacity Storage (RCS) allows you to obtain discounts on Wasabi storage in exchange for an up-front payment and commitment to a 1, 3 or 5 year term. RCS comes in fixed increments starting at 25 TBs that scales up to PBs

Backblaze B2 offers multi-tenant capabilities through its Partner API and Cloud Storage Business Groups but does not offer a turnkey storage-as-a-service platform like Wasabi Account Control Manager. The Wasabi Account Control Manager is designed for managed service providers or enterprises that need to manage many Wasabi accounts in one place. Wasabi Account Control Manager simplifies and automates the creation, management, and billing of cloud storage accounts.
